What are Steroids?

Steroids are synthetic drugs that mimic the effects of the male hormone testosterone. They are often used by athletes and bodybuilders to increase muscle mass and strength, improve endurance, and reduce recovery time. While some steroids are legally prescribed by doctors to treat certain medical conditions, many individuals misuse them for their performance-enhancing properties.

The Result of Intake

One of the most concerning effects of steroid intake is the impact it has on the liver. Steroids can cause liver damage and increase the risk of developing liver cancer. Additionally, steroids can disrupt the balance of hormones in the body, leading to a range of side effects such as acne, hair loss, and infertility. Long-term use of steroids can also weaken the immune system, making individuals more susceptible to infections and illnesses.

Dangerous Psychological Effects

In addition to the physical effects, steroids can also have dangerous psychological effects. Some individuals who misuse steroids may experience mood swings, aggression, legalsteroidshopusa and paranoia. This can lead to violent behavior and social isolation. Long-term steroid use has also been linked to depression and anxiety disorders.
